I have a toyota corolla fwd. It's bone stock and has to stay that way. I run on a 3/8 high banked oval. Anybody got any set up tips. Ex. Air pressure what size tires? I just started anything would be a great help.

I am not sure what your rules are but I can try to help you. I would try to run a 195/60r14 or 195/60r15. Pressure would be LF-26, RF-35, LR -27, RR -33. Also I would air all tires up to the same psi (normally I do 35psi) and measure the outside diameter of each tire. Most tires will not be the same diameter. From there I would try to find a way to get some stagger. Put the smallest tire on the lf and biggest on the rr.
